<p>Tropical Storm Gordon made landfall on the Gulf Coast of Alabama just after 10pm on Tuesday, September 4, bringing heavy winds, intense rain and flooding.</p><p>ABC reported</a> a state of emergency was in effect in Mississippi, Louisiana and parts of Alabama.</p><p>According to the Washington Post winds were nearly at hurricane force</a>.</p><p>At least one person died and around 21,000 were without power, The Weather Channel</a> reported.</p><p>In this video, taken from the Phoenix I hotel, strong winds and waves can be seen crashing on Orange Beach.
